This museum near downtown is the only major institution dedicated exclusively to the achievements of women artists. Housed in a restored Renaissance Revival building that once served as a Masonic temple, it features a grand marble Great Hall used for events. The collection spans five centuries, from Renaissance and Baroque painters to modern and contemporary artists. Its programs continue a founding mission of correcting women's underrepresentation in art history.
